Law of Dominance: The characters were controlled by discrete units called factors which occur in pairs. In a dissimilar pair of factors one member of the pair is dominant & the other is recessive.
(i) This law gives an explanation to the monohybrid cross.
(a) the expression of only one of the parental characters in F1 generation.
(b) the expression of both in the F2 generation
(ii) It also explains the proportion of 3:1 obtained at the F2
Monohybrid Cross
(i) Monohybrid inheritance is the inheritance of a single character i. e, plant height.
(ii) It involves the inheritance of two alleles of a single gene.
(iii) When the F1 generation was selfed Mendel noticed that 7847 of 1064 F2 plants were tall, while 277of 1064 were dwarf.
(iv) When tall pea plants were pollinated with the pollens from a true breeding dwarf plants, the result was all tall plants.
(v) Dwarf trait appears in the F2 generation.
(vi) When the parental types were reversed, the result was the same - All tall plants.
(vii) Tall (♀) \(\times\) Dwarf (♂) and Tall (♂) \(\times\) Dwarf (♀) mating's are done in both ways.
(viii) It was concluded that the trait is not sex dependent.
(xi) The gene for plant height has two alleles: Tall (T) \(\times\) Dwarf (t). (TT, Tt, Tt: tt)

Atavism is a modification of a biological structure whereby an ancestral trait reappears after having been lost through evolutionary changes in the previous generations. Evolutionary traits that have disappeared phenotypically do not necessarily disappear from an organism's DNA. The gene sequence often remains, but is inactive. Such an unused gene may remain in the genome for many generations. As long as the gene remains intact, a fault in the genetic control suppressing the gene can lead to the reappearance of that character again. Reemergence of sexual reproduction in the flowering plant Hieracium pilosella is the best example for Atavism in plants.

The Law of Segregation (Law of Purity of gametes): Alleles do not show any blending. During the formation of gametes, the factors or alleles of a pair separate and segregate from each other such that each gamete receives only one of the two factors. A homozygous parent produces similar gametes and a heterozygous parent produces two kinds of gametes each having one allele with equal proportion. Gametes are never hybrid.
